Taula de continguts:

Què és Union a PostgreSQL?
Què és Union a PostgreSQL?

Vídeo: Què és Union a PostgreSQL?

Vídeo: Què és Union a PostgreSQL?
Vídeo: Combine SQL Queries With UNION, INTERSECT, EXCEPT 2024, Maig
Anonim

El UNIÓ PostgreSQL La clàusula/operador s'utilitza per combinar els resultats de dues o més sentències SELECT sense retornar cap fila duplicada.

De la mateixa manera, us podeu preguntar, quina diferència hi ha entre unió i unió?

En un sindicat , les columnes no es combinen per crear resultats, les files es combinen. Tots dos associacions i sindicats es pot utilitzar per combinar dades d'una o més taules en un sol resultat. Tots dos van d'una manera diferent. Mentre que a uneix-te s'utilitza per combinar columnes de diferents taules, el Unió s'utilitza per combinar files.

De la mateixa manera, com s'escriu una consulta menys a PostgreSQL? L'EXCEPTE operador retorna tots els registres del primer SELECT declaració que no estan a la segona SELECT declaració . L'EXCEPTE operador a PostgreSQL és equivalent al Operador MENYS a Oracle.

Tenint això a la vista, com puc unir dues taules a PostgreSQL?

Per unir la taula A a la taula B:

  1. En primer lloc, especifiqueu la columna de les dues taules de la qual voleu seleccionar les dades a la clàusula SELECT.
  2. En segon lloc, especifiqueu la taula principal, és a dir, A a la clàusula FROM.
  3. En tercer lloc, especifiqueu la taula a la qual s'uneix la taula principal, és a dir, B a la clàusula INNER JOIN.

Què és la fusió a PostgreSQL?

PostgreSQL COALESCE sintaxi de la funció The COALESCE La funció accepta un nombre il·limitat d'arguments. Retorna el primer argument que no és nul. Si tots els arguments són nuls, el COALESCE La funció retornarà nul. El COALESCE La funció avalua els arguments d'esquerra a dreta fins que troba el primer argument no nul.

Recomanat: